Here is a sample of time series analysis algorithms available on Algorithmia: FourierDetrend; Time Series Summary Statistics; Fast Anomaly Detection; Outlier Detection; Auto Correlate; Tensorflow LSTM predictor; Remove Seasonality; Forecast; Thanks for joining us for our Introduction to Time Series Analysis, and happy coding! Continue readin Why dedicated algorithms for time series? Time series classification algorithms tend to perform better than tabular classifiers on time series classification problems. A common, but problematic solution to time series classification is to treat each time point as a separate feature and directly apply a standard learning algorithm (e.g. scikit-learn classifiers). In this approach, the algorithm ignores information contained in the time order of the data. If the feature order were scrambled. The Microsoft Time Series algorithm provides multiple algorithms that are optimized for forecasting continuous values, such as product sales, over time. Whereas other Microsoft algorithms, such as decision trees, require additional columns of new information as input to predict a trend, a time series model does not. A time series model can predict trends based only on the original dataset that is used to create the model. You can also add new data to the model when you make a prediction and. A time series is a series of data points indexed (or listed or graphed) in time order. Most commonly, a time series is a sequence taken at successive equally spaced points in time. Thus it is a sequence of discrete-time data. Examples of time series are heights of ocean tides, counts of sunspots, and the daily closing value of the Dow Jones Industrial Average. Time series are very frequently plotted via run charts (a temporal line chart). Time series are used in statistics, signal processing, p
Time-Series Data Analysis & Machine Learning Algorithm for Stock Trading. A case study with technical analysis, feature selection, accuracy score & bias-variance trade-off . Sarit Maitra. Follow. . The objective of time series comparison methods.. Time Series Analysis. This tool analyzes time series data using Socrata Open Government data on building permits to identify development trends in various cities
hydrological time series by Markov chain Monte Carlo (MCMC) algorithm. We consider multiple change-points and various possible situations. The approach of Bayesian stochastic search selection is used for detecting and estimating the number and positions of possible change-point in a piecewise constant model. MCMC algorithm is used to estimat Time Series Analysis: Unsupervised Anomaly Detection Beyond Outlier Detection Max Landauer 1, Markus Wurzenberger , Florian Skopik , Giuseppe Settanni1, and Peter Filzmoser2 1 Austrian Institute of Technology, Austria, email@example.com 2 Vienna University of Technology, Austria, firstname.lastname@example.org Abstract. Anomaly detection on log data is an important security mech-anism. Fit ARIMA: order=(1, 0, 1) seasonal_order=(0, 1, 1, 12); AIC=536.818, BIC=556.362, Fit time=2.083 seconds Fit ARIMA: order=(0, 0, 0) seasonal_order=(0, 1, 0, 12); AIC=626.061, BIC=635.834, Fit time=0.033 seconds Fit ARIMA: order=(1, 0, 0) seasonal_order=(1, 1, 0, 12); AIC=598.004, BIC=614.292, Fit time=0.682 seconds Fit ARIMA: order=(0, 0, 1) seasonal_order=(0, 1, 1, 12); AIC=613.475, BIC=629.762, Fit time=0.510 seconds Fit ARIMA: order=(1, 0, 1) seasonal_order=(1, 1, 1, 12); AIC=559.530.
Keywords: spectral analysis, irregularly sampled time series, wavelets, fast algorithms, eco-nomic time series, geologic time series. 1. Introduction Despite the vast number of methods for time series analysis, there is still a lack in manage-able methods dealing with nonuniformly sampled data. In this paper, we present a spectral analysis method based upon least square approximation, applied. What is the Sentiment Time Series Algorithm? The Sentiment Time Series algorithm is a microservice that combines the Social Sentiment Analysis algorithm and the R time series libraries dplyr, plyr, and rjson to produce a sentiment plot showing positive, negative, and neutral trends. The API returns a JSON file with the frequencies grouped by sentiment and the corresponding dates with classical time series algorithms, to analyse predictive distributions of estimated parameters. There are three main phases to be analysed: phase one will be about Time Series analysis, phase two will be MCMC series and phase three will be the MCMC analysis for classical time series. Isambi Sailon MCMC analysis of classical time series algorithms As the name states, it is suitable for seasonal time series, which is the most popular case. If you analyze deviation of residue and introduce some threshold for it, you'll get an anomaly detection algorithm. The not obvious part here is that you should use median absolute deviation to get a more robust detection of anomalies Time series forecasting is a technique in machine learning, which analyzes data and the sequence of time to predict future events. This technique provides near accurate assumptions about future trends based on historical time-series data. Time series allows you to analyze major patterns such as trends, seasonality, cyclicity, and irregularity. It is used for various applications such as stock market analysis, pattern recognition, earthquake prediction, economic forecasting, census analysis.
Automatic algorithms for time series forecasting 2. Motivation 1 Common in business to have over 1000 products that need forecasting at least monthly. 2 Forecasts are often required by people who are untrained in time series analysis. Speciﬁcations Automatic forecasting algorithms must: å determine an appropriate time series model; å estimate the parameters; å compute the forecasts with. Uncertainty in time series can appear in many ways, and its analysis can be performed based on different theories. An important problem appears when time series is incomplete since the analyst should.. Spectrum analysis can be considered as a topic in statistics as well as a topic in digital signal processing (DSP). This book takes a middle course by emphasizing the time series models and their impact on spectrum analysis. The text begins with elements of probability theory and goes on to introduce the theory of stationary stochastic. Algorithms for Linear Time Series Analysis: With R Package. 2007. Ian Mcleo If you need to difference your original time series data d times in order to obtain a stationary time series, this means that you can use an ARIMA(p,d,q) model for your time series, where d is the order of differencing used. For example, for the time series of the diameter of women's skirts, we had to difference the time series twice, and so the order of differencing (d) is 2. This means.
This paper presents an efficient algorithm, called dynamic fuzzy cluster (DFC), for dynamically clustering time series by introducing the definition of key point and improving FCM algorithm. The proposed algorithm works by determining those time series whose class labels are vague and further partitions them into different clusters over time The below are the previous articles in this series. Shopping Basket Analysis in SQL Server Using Decision Trees in SQL Server Data Mining Cluster Analysis in SQL Server This article focuses Time Series Algorithms which are a forecasting technique. One of the most common algorithms used in industry are time series algorithms which can be used to answer questions on the future values such sales. Multivariate time series with intrinsic features such as high dimensionality and similarity measure makes the clustering progress more complex than univariate time series. Principal component analysis (PCA) , , , , is a common method to transform MTS into a new coordinate space to find the major features. In other words, the first K principal. Analysis of Various Periodicity Detection Algorithms in Time Series Data with Design of New Algorithm Shital P. Hatkar BAMU University Aditya Engineering College Beed, India S.H.Kadam BAMU University Aditya Engineering College, Beed, India Syed A.H BAMU University Aditya Engineering College, Beed, India Abstract:Time series datasets consist of sequence of numeric values obtained over repeated.
Time series correlation algorithm and analysis steps __ Time series. Last Update:2018-08-20 Source: Internet Author: User. Tags truncated statsmodels. Developer on Alibaba Coud: Build your first app with APIs, SDKs, and tutorials on the Alibaba Cloud. Read more ＞ First of all, from the point of view of time can be a series of basically divided into 3 categories: 1. Pure random sequence. of modern data analysis. Although data structures and algorithms classically used in 2D and 3D turn out to be inefﬁcient for the analysis of these structures 1, recent topological and geometric approaches provide new and promising tools to address this problem [1, 2, 3]. Time series data sets are of particular interest for these kind of. Data from Shumway and Stoffer (2017, 4th ed) Time Series Analysis and Its Applications: With R Examples are in the astsa package. Data from Tsay (2005, 2nd ed) Analysis of Financial Time Series are in the FinTS package 2. Time Series Analysis. Now that we've learnt about Pandas for time series data, let's shift focus on analysis techniques. Time series data has special properties and a different set of predictive algorithms than other types of data. A lot of financial data comes in the form of some value plotted against a time series
Our analysis uncovers the time-series structure of outbreak severity for highly pathogenic avain influenza (H5N1) in Egypt. View. Show abstract. Deep learning with long short-term memory networks. The Sentiment Time Series algorithm is a microservice that combines the Social Sentiment Analysis algorithm and the R time series libraries dplyr, plyr, and rjson to produce a sentiment plot showing positive, negative, and neutral trends. The API returns a JSON file with the frequencies grouped by sentiment and the corresponding dates. The microservice groups the data by date and sentiment to. ASTSA is a windows time series package that you can download right here. Follow these directions: Step 1: Save zastsa.exe to your desktop (zastsa.exe is a self-extracting zip file). Step 2: Put an EMPTY formatted disk into your floppy drive. Step 3: Double click on the ZASTSA icon on your desktop. This will create an installation disk. Step 4: Install ASTSA from the floppy. It's a good idea to.
This involves aggregating and pivoting the data and creating time intervals. The Time Series algorithm in SPSS Modeler has an automated procedure to create models that in most of the cases works well. So we will use the expert modeller (the automated procedure) that will try to fit various models and pick the best. Here are the results: It makes sense that in 2 of the time series SPSS used the. In many cases, algorithms developed for time-series clustering take static clustering algorithms and either modify the similarity deﬁnition, or the prototype extraction function to an appropriate one, or apply a transformation to the series so that static features are obtained (Liao,2005) In the last few years, doing the Time Series Forecasting has become drastically easier thanks to the Prophet algorithm available in R and Python.. We have made it even easier to access through a great UI experience of Exploratory. In this post, I'm going to introduce the Prophet algorithm, and how you can use it in Exploratory An interrupted time series with segmented regression analysis was used to evaluate differences in monthly composite IV antibiotic DOTs and clinical outcomes associated with the implementation of a revised febrile neutropenia management algorithm
DEVELOPMENT AND ANALYSIS OF GENETIC ALGORITHM FOR TIME SERIES FORECASTING PROBLEM Leonid Hulianytskyi, Anna Pavlenko Abstract: This paper presents developed genetic-based algorithm for time series forecasting problem and describes approaches to learning procedures design. Different techniques of population representation, recombination, formation of niches, calculation of fitness, conflict. The time order can be daily, monthly, or even yearly. Given below is an example of a Time Series that illustrates the number of passengers of an airline per month from the year 1949 to 1960. Time Series Forecasting Time Series forecasting is the process of using a statistical model to predict future values of a time series based on past results Introduction to Time Series Analysis. Lecture 9. Peter Bartlett 1. Review: Forecasting 2. Partial autocorrelation function. 3. Recursive methods: Durbin-Levinson. 4. The innovations representation. 5. Recursive methods: Innovations algorithm. 6. Example: Innovations algorithm for forecasting an MA(1) The most common application of time series analysis is forecasting future values of a numeric value using the temporal structure of the data. This means, the available observations are used to predict values from the future. The temporal ordering of the data, implies that traditional regression methods are not useful. In order to build robust forecast, we need models that take into account the.
APPROPRIATE ALGORITHMS FOR NONLINEAR TIME SERIES ANALYSIS IN PSYCHOLOGY CHRISTIAN SCHEIER AILab, University ofZurich-Irchel Winterthurerstrasse 190 8057Zurich E-mail:email@example.com WOLFGANG TSCHACHER University Psychiatric Services Bern: Mid and West Sectors Laupenstrasse 29 3010 Bern E-mail:firstname.lastname@example.org Chaos theory has a strong appealfor psychologybecause it allows for the. From time series analysis to a modified ordinary differential equation Meiyu Xue1 and Choi-Hong Lai2 Abstract In understanding Big Data, people are interested to obtain the trend and dynamics of a given set of temporal data, which in turn can be used to predict possible futures. This paper examines a time series analysis method and an ordinary differential equation approach in modeling the.
Deep Learning for Time Series Modeling CS 229 Final Project Report Enzo Busseti, Ian Osband, Scott Wong December 14th, 2012 1 Energy Load Forecasting Demand forecasting is crucial to electricity providers because their ability to produce energy exceeds their ability to store it. Excess demand can cause \brown outs, while excess supply ends in waste. In an industry worth over $1 trillion in. Always remember that time series algorithms work on stationary data only hence making a series stationary is an important aspect. 5. Predictions. After fitting our model, we will be predicting the future in this stage. Since we are now familiar with a basic flow of solving a time series problem, let us get to the implementation. Problem Statement The dataset can be downloaded from here. It. Time series analysis has become increasingly important in diverse fields including medicine, aerospace, finance, business, meteorology, and entertainment. Time series data are sequences of measurements over time describing the behavior of systems. These behaviors can change over time due to external events and/or internal systematic changes in dynamics/distribution . Change point detection. You are conducting an exploratory analysis of time-series data. To make sure you have the best picture of your data, you'll want to separate long-trends and seasonal changes from the random fluctuations. In this article, we'll describe some of the time smoothers commonly used to help you do this. These include both global methods, which involve fitting a regression over the whole time series. Algorithm summary. In a 1-dimensional setting (time series, real-valued signal) the algorithm can be easily described by the following figure: Think of the function graph (or its sub-level set) as a landscape and consider a decreasing water level starting at level infinity (or 1.8 in this picture). While the level decreases, at local maxima islands pop up. At local minima these islands merge together. One detail in this idea is that the island that appeared later in time is merged into the.
LSAR: E cient Leverage Score Sampling Algorithm for the Analysis of Big Time Series Data Ali Eshragh Fred Roostay Asef Nazariz Michael W. Mahoneyx December 14, 2020 Abstract We apply methods from randomized numerical linear algebra (RandNLA) to de-velop improved algorithms for the analysis of large-scale time series data. We rst develop a new fast algorithm to estimate the leverage scores of. What is Time Series Analysis? Firstly, a time series is defined as some quantity that is measured sequentially in time over some interval. In its broadest form, time series analysis is about inferring what has happened to a series of data points in the past and attempting to predict what will happen to it the future I'm trying to score as many time series algorithms as possible on my data so that I can pick the best one / ensemble. r regression time-series anomaly-detection Share. Cite. Improve this question . Follow edited Jul 14 '17 at 23:47. kjetil b halvorsen ♦ 52.5k 21 21 gold badges 119 119 silver badges 382 382 bronze badges. asked Feb 10 '15 at 14:58. Eric Miller Eric Miller. 431 2 2 gold. T1 - Benchmarking of Regression Algorithms and Time Series Analysis Techniques for Sales Forecasting. AU - Catal, Cagatay. AU - Ece, Kaan. AU - Arslan, Begum. AU - Akbulut, Akhan. PY - 2019/1/31. Y1 - 2019/1/31. N2 - Predicting the sales amount as close as to the actual sales amount can provide many benefits to companies. Since the fashion industry is not easily predictable, it is not.
Abstract: In many real-world application, e.g., speech recognition or sleep stage classification, data are captured over the course of time, constituting a Time-Series. Time-Series often contain temporal dependencies that cause two otherwise identical points of time to belong to different classes or predict different behavior. This characteristic generally increases the difficulty of analysing them. Existing techniques often depended on hand-crafted features that were expensive to. Time series algorithms show how a given value changes over time. With time series analysis and time series forecasting, data is collected at regular intervals over time and used to make predictions and identify trends, seasonality, cyclicity, and irregularity. Time series algorithms are used to answer questions like
The algorithm for time series analysis and forecasting. The algorithm for analyzing the time series for forecasting sales in Excel can be constructed in three steps: We select to the trend component using the regression function. We determine the seasonal component in the form of coefficients. We calculate the forecast values for a certain period. To see the general picture with the graphs. Time series analysis is the analysis of time-dependent data. Given data for a certain period, the aim is to predict data for a different period, usually in the future. For example, time series analysis is used to predict financial markets, earthquakes, and weather
Definitions. KNN algorithm = K-nearest-neighbour classification algorithm. K-means = centroid-based clustering algorithm. DTW = Dynamic Time Warping a similarity-measurement algorithm for time-series. I show below step by step about how the two time-series can be built and how the Dynamic Time Warping (DTW) algorithm can be computed not discrete, but real-valued time series? In this case, repeated pattern discovery can help* *Yuan Hao, Yanping Chen et al (2013). Towards Never-Ending Learning from Time Series Streams. SIGKDD 2013 Note the mapping is non-linear, the learning algorithms in this domain are non-trivial. If you have parallel texts, then over time yo In the third section, clustering algorithms of time-series data are examined under five main headings according to the method used. In the last part of the study, the use of time-series clustering in bioinformatics which is one of the favorite areas is included. 2. Time-series clustering approaches. There are many different categorizations of time-series clustering approaches. Such as, time. Description. Provides functions for modeling and forecasting time series data. Forecasting is based on the innovations algorithm. A description of the innovations algorithm can be found in the textbook Introduction to Time Series and Forecasting by Peter J. Brockwell and Richard A. Davis
His research in econometrics, finance, time series analysis, forecasting methods and statistical software has led to numerous publications in scientific journals and books. He serves as an econometric and statistical consultant and trainer for numerous companies and organizations including central banks, commercial and investment banks, bureau of statistics, bureau of economic analysis. The time series algorithm takes only a single key time column and a predictable column -- you could also put in an optional key series column. In your case, I would flatten the table using the Unified Dimensional Model in Analysis Services (use BIDS) to properly join the sales figures with the identifying product and other descriptions (from dimension tables). Put into other words, you need to.
Some published examples of cluster analysis in time series have been based on environmental data, where we have time series from di erent locations and wish to group locations which show similar behavior. See, for instance,Macchiatoetal.[ ] for a spatial clustering of daily ambient temperature, or Cowpertwait and Cox [ ]foran application to a rainfall problem. Other examples can be found in. Time series clustering is important in the analysis of action. In the domain of transportation, it is especially important. It allows an understanding of people's activities within a time period. In this article, a method is presented for the segmentation of time series algorithms for time series. On the temperature time series datasets, the authors showed that classical algorithms and machine-learning-based algorithms can be equally used. There are some limitations of time series approaches for sales forecasting. Here are some of them: • We need to have historical data for a long time period to capture seasonality. However, often we do not have historical. Prediction Using Time Series Algorithm Lakshmana Phaneendra Maguluri#, R. Ragupathy* #,* Department of Computer Science and Engineering Annamalai University, Annamalai Nagar, Chidambaram, Tamil Nadu 608002, INDIA #email@example.com. *firstname.lastname@example.org Abstract — As the Company's financial values change day-by-day with uncertainty, forecasting of the stock market prices is a. CiteSeerX - Scientific articles matching the query: An algorithm for time series analysis of ice sheet surface elevations from satellite altimetry Prophet is an open-source tool from Facebook used for forecasting time series data which helps businesses understand and possibly predict the market. It is based on a decomposable additive model where non-linear trends are fit with seasonality, it also takes into account the effects of holidays. Before we head right into coding, let's learn certain terms that are required to understand this